Position Purpose:
The APG Manager is responsible for the management of United Refining's Asset Performance Group including team member performance, directing team activities, and ensuring the team achieves its goals. The team manages specific support functions related to the safe, regulatorily compliant, and efficient operation and maintenance of the pipelines and terminals that supply the United Refining Company's Warren, PA refinery and the terminals used to distribute United Refining products.
Specific APG functions include:
  • Pipeline and terminal integrity (e.g., pipeline in-line inspection) program management
  • Management of pipeline SCADA control systems, associated applications (e.g., leak detection), and supporting communications and security infrastructure
  • Project management services for improvement and repair projects across the associated facilities and systems
  • Managing related procedures, documents, data, and reports
  • Integrating seamlessly with related organizations to achieve team and cross-functional goals
